The Benefits of Wearing Safety Goggles
Safety goggles are essential protective equipment designed to safeguard the eyes from potential hazards such as chemicals, dust, and other airborne particles. They serve a multitude of purposes, not only in laboratories but across various industries. Here are some key benefits of wearing safety goggles in a laboratory setting:
Prevention of Eye Injuries: Safeguarding against splashes, splinters, and other harmful substances that could potentially harm the eyes. Improved Vision: Providing clear and unobstructed vision, which is crucial for carrying out precise tasks and monitoring experiments. There are several types of safety goggles available, each designed to cater to different types of hazards and laboratory environments. These include:
Impact-Resistant Goggles: Constructed from polycarbonate, offering exceptional protection against high-impact particles and sharps. Hazard-Specific Goggles: Designed for specific hazards such as chemical splashes, dust, and light radiation. Typically, the laboratory safety rules and guidelines are established and enforced by the laboratory director, graduate advisor, or the principal investigator. These rules are designed to ensure the safety and well-being of all individuals working in the laboratory. Key safety rules include:
Wearing Personal Protective Equipment (PPE): This includes safety goggles, lab coats, gloves, and other necessary protective gear tailored to the specific hazards present in the laboratory. Proper Handling of Chemicals: Adhering to safe handling, storage, and disposal procedures for all chemicals used in the laboratory. Failure to adhere to these safety rules can have serious consequences, including both personal injury and financial repercussions. In the event of an accident, the laboratory may face operational disruptions, legal actions, and potentially expensive insurance claims. Compliance with safety guidelines not only protects individuals but also ensures the smooth functioning of the laboratory.
